A letter of request for an Authorization to Construct was received on July 19, 2019,by the
Division of Water Resources (Division), and final plans and specifications for the subject project
have been reviewed and found to be satisfactory. Authorization is hereby granted for the
construction of modifications to the existing 0.675 MGD Scotland Neck WWTP, with discharge
of treated wastewater into the Canal Creek in the Tar-Pamlico River Basin.
This authorization results in no increase in design or permitted capacity and is awarded for
the construction of the following specific modifications:
Conversion of existing clarifier #2 to sludge thickener; construction of new 36 ft
diameter by 12 ft side water depth secondary clarifier#2; installation of two (2) new
230 GPM 5 HP submersible sludge RAS pumps, two (2) new 230 GPM 3 HP
submersible WAS pumps, and one (1) new 20 GPM 1 HP submersible scum pump;
installation of all required piping and controls; in conformity with the project plans,
specifications, and other supporting documentation comprising the ATC Permit
Application package submitted to the Department of Environmental Quality.
This ATC is issued in accordance with Part III, Paragraph A of NPDES Permit No.
NC0023337 issued effective August 1, 2015, and shall be subject to revocation unless the
wastewater treatment facilities are constructed in accordance with the conditions and limitations
specified in Permit No. NC0023337.
It is the Owner's responsibility to ensure that the as-constructed project meets the
requirements of all applicable regulations and statutes, the ATC Permit Application package, and
all of the requirements contained herein. Failure to comply may result in penalties in accordance
with North Carolina General Statute §143-215.6A through §143-215.6C.

The sludge generated from these treatment facilities must be disposed of in accordance
with G.S. 143-215.1 and in a manner approved by the Division.
In the event that the facilities fail to perform satisfactorily, including the creation of
nuisance conditions, the Permittee shall take immediate corrective action, including those as may
be required by the Division, such as the construction of additional or replacement wastewater
treatment or disposal facilities.
The Raleigh Regional Office, telephone number 919-791-4200, shall be notified at least
forty-eight(48)hours in advance of operation of the installed facilities so that an on-site inspection
can be made. Such notification to the regional supervisor shall be made during the normal office
hours from 8:00 a.m. until 5:00 p.m. on Monday through Friday, excluding State Holidays.
Upon completion of construction and prior to operation of this permitted facility, a
certification must be received from a Professional Engineer certifying that the permitted facility
has been installed in accordance with the NPDES Permit and the ATC Permit Application package.
Mail the Certification to: Division of Water Resources, WQ Permitting — NPDES, 1617 Mail
Service Center, Raleigh,NC 27699-1617.
Upon classification of the facility by the Certification Commission, the Permittee shall
employ a certified wastewater treatment plant operator to be in responsible charge (ORC) of the
wastewater treatment facilities. The operator must hold a certificate of the type and grade at least
equivalent to or greater than the classification assigned to the wastewater treatment facilities by
the Certification Commission.
The Permittee must also employ a certified back-up operator of the appropriate type and
grade to comply with the conditions of T15A:8G.0202. The ORC of the facility must visit each
Class I facility at least weekly and each Class II, III and IV facility at least daily, excluding
weekends and holidays, must properly manage the facility, must document daily operation and
maintenance of the facility, and must comply with all other conditions of T15A:8G.0202.
A copy of the project plans and specifications shall be maintained on file by the
Permittee for the life of the facility.
During the construction of the proposed additions/modifications, the Permittee shall
continue to properly maintain and operate the existing wastewater treatment facilities at all times,
and in such a manner, as necessary to comply with the effluent limits specified in the NPDES
Permit.
You are reminded that it is mandatory for the project to be constructed in accordance with
the North Carolina Sedimentation Pollution Control Act, and when applicable,the North Carolina
Dam Safety Act. In addition, the specifications must clearly state what the contractor's
responsibilities shall be in complying with these Acts.
